Electrostatic potentials using direct-lattice summations

V. R. Marathe*, S. Lauer, A. X. Trautwein

*Corresponding author for this work

Abstract

A direct-lattice summation scheme is described which is completely general for one-, two-, and three-dimensional periodic arrays of point charges. This scheme is based on a proper rearrangement of terms within the lattice sum. Rapid convergence is achieved by appropriate cancellation of multipolar terms.
